Hail Damage Risk for Your Home+
Hail reports describe hail by diameter, often comparing stone size to familiar objects like peas, quarters, golf balls, and softballs. Use this guide as a starting point for possible hail damage to your roof, siding, gutters, vents, windows, and exterior. Actual hail damage depends on hail hardness, density, wind speed, impact angle, roof age, shingle condition, roof pitch, roofing material, installation quality, and prior storm damage.

Source: NOAA / National Weather Service hail size references are used for hail-size comparisons and the 1.00″ severe-hail threshold. Damage descriptions are general homeowner guidance, not official NOAA/NWS damage ratings. Sub-severe hail under 1.00″ is below the severe threshold, but that does not mean “no roof damage.” Penny- to nickel-size hail can still contribute to granule loss, cosmetic surface marks, and added wear, especially on older, brittle, poorly installed, or previously damaged roofs.

Mercer County · 14,653 Homes in County
Tornado Report Description: The tornado briefly touched down to the West of River Train Road. Ten percent of a large aluminum barn was removed and had four garage doors blown out. Some of the debris from this building caused collateral impact damage to surrounding structures on both north and south facing aspects. A large dent occurred near the top of the southwest side of a grain silo. Another aluminum building incurred siding damage and a second story window was blown in from the south. This property was surrounded by farmland and no additional damage was noted in the area. Based on the damage surveyed, the maximum wind speed from this tornado was estimated to be 75 miles per hour.

Tornado Damage Risk for Your Home+
After a tornado, the National Weather Service assigns an EF rating from EF0 to EF5 based on surveyed damage. The rating estimates wind speed from what the tornado damaged, so actual damage can vary by construction quality, roof age, garage doors, windows, trees, debris, and how close the home was to the tornado path.

Source: NOAA / National Weather Service. EF ratings are assigned after a post-storm damage survey and are based on observed damage, not a direct measurement at every home.
